Majogami Steam Version Has Been Delayed

Due to a "delay in the platform review process."

Inti Creates has announced the Steam version of action “paper craft” platformer Majogami has been delayed to a later date due to a “delay in the platform review process” on Valve’s platform. Majogami was originally planned to release on Steam alongside the Nintendo Switch and Nintendo Switch 2 versions today, October 30.

Here’s the full statement from Inti Creates, via the game’s Steam blog post:

We regrettably have encountered a delay in the platform review process on Steam for Majogami’s release, intended for 12:00 AM Pacific on October 30th. Releases on other platforms are unaffected.

This is understandably frustrating for players looking forward to the game on Steam, in particular players who have pre-ordered Majogami. We are doing all that we can to release the game as soon as possible.

We will keep you updated on the situation and provide a new release time when possible.

You our sincere apology for this situation, and thanks for your understanding.

Majogami costs $34.99 for Nintendo Switch and $39.99 for Nintendo Switch 2, and both games are available in the Nintendo eShop digitally. A Majogami demo is also available now in the Nintendo eShop.

The Steam version of Majogami costs $24.99, and and pre-orders included a “Majogami – Director’s Selection Album” bonus featuring the full background music in .mp3 (256kbps) format. More details about the Steam release are coming at a later date.
